Impact on Real Estate Investment Trusts (REITs)

[Real estate investment trusts (REITs) are financial vehicles that invest in properties and generate income for their investors. When interest rates rise, the cost of capital for REITs increases, potentially reducing their profits and share prices. However, some REITs may be less affected by interest rate changes if they have long-term leases or stable cash flows.]– AI Content Generator

EXTRA & FINAL THOUGHT

According to most real estate experts, some real estate tends to hold up well against inflation. However not every property will benefit from this economic volatility. Not every one has inflation resistance.

***Source of material below is from The Motley Fool (fool.com). Thank You***

[“The real estate investments that tend to perform best in inflationary environments have the following characteristics:

Short lease duration: Some types of commercial properties use long-term leases that have small annual rent increases built in, while others are shorter-duration and reset to market rates more frequently. Those in the latter category tend to perform better during inflationary periods.

Pricing power: Inflation-resistant investments typically have the ability to pass price increases along to their customers. As an example, apartment REITs are an essential type of property (people need places to live), which gives landlords the ability to raise rent along with the market. On the other hand, mall REITs might be less flexible, as rapid rent increases could cause some tenants to think twice about keeping their stores open.

Resilient demand: Shorter lease duration don’t help if you can’t find enough tenants to fill your properties. So, it’s smart to consider properties that will remain in demand even if prices rise. Think industrial real estate — the surge in e-commerce has created such a need for logistics real estate that industrial REITs simply can’t build properties fast enough. ]
